GitHub
Access the GitHub REST API with managed OAuth authentication. Manage repositories, issues, pull requests, commits, branches, users, and more.
Quick Start
# Get authenticated user
python <<'EOF'
import urllib.request, os, json
req = urllib.request.Request('https://api.maton.ai/github/user')
req.add_header('Authorization', f'Bearer {os.environ["MATON_API_KEY"]}')
print(json.dumps(json.load(urllib.request.urlopen(req)), indent=2))
EOFBase URL
https://api.maton.ai/github/{native-api-path}Maton proxies requests to api.github.com and automatically injects your OAuth token.
Authentication
All requests require the Maton API key in the Authorization header:
Authorization: Bearer $MATON_API_KEYEnvironment Variable: Set your API key as MATON_API_KEY:
export MATON_API_KEY="YOUR_API_KEY"Getting Your API Key

API Reference
Users
Get Authenticated User
GET /github/userGet User by Username
GET /github/users/{username}List Users
GET /github/users?since={user_id}&per_page=30Repositories
List User Repositories
GET /github/user/repos?per_page=30&sort=updatedQuery parameters: type (all, owner, public, private, member), sort (created, updated, pushed, full_name), direction (asc, desc), per_page, page
List Organization Repositories
GET /github/orgs/{org}/repos?per_page=30Get Repository
GET /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}Create Repository (User)
POST /github/user/repos
Content-Type: application/json
{
"name": "my-new-repo",
"description": "A new repository",
"private": true,
"auto_init": true
}Create Repository (Organization)
POST /github/orgs/{org}/repos
Content-Type: application/json
{
"name": "my-new-repo",
"description": "A new repository",
"private": true
}Update Repository
PATCH /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}
Content-Type: application/json
{
"description": "Updated description",
"has_issues": true,
"has_wiki": false
}Delete Repository
DELETE /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}Repository Contents
List Contents
GET /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/contents/{path}Get File Contents
GET /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/contents/{path}?ref={branch}Create or Update File
PUT /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/contents/{path}
Content-Type: application/json
{
"message": "Create new file",
"content": "SGVsbG8gV29ybGQh",
"branch": "main"
}Note: content must be Base64 encoded.

}Pull Requests
List Pull Requests
GET /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/pulls?state=open&per_page=30Query parameters: state (open, closed, all), head, base, sort, direction, per_page, page
Get Pull Request
GET /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/pulls/{pull_number}Create Pull Request
POST /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/pulls
Content-Type: application/json
{
"title": "New feature",
"body": "Description of changes",
"head": "feature-branch",
"base": "main",
"draft": false
}Update Pull Request
PATCH /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/pulls/{pull_number}
Content-Type: application/json
{
"title": "Updated title",
"state": "closed"
}List Pull Request Commits
GET /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/pulls/{pull_number}/commits?per_page=30List Pull Request Files
GET /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/pulls/{pull_number}/files?per_page=30Check If Merged
GET /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/pulls/{pull_number}/mergeMerge Pull Request
PUT /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/pulls/{pull_number}/merge
Content-Type: application/json
{
"commit_title": "Merge pull request",
"merge_method": "squash"
}Merge methods: merge, squash, rebase
Pull Request Reviews
List Reviews
GET /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/pulls/{pull_number}/reviews?per_page=30Create Review
POST /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/pulls/{pull_number}/reviews
Content-Type: application/json
{
"body": "Looks good!",
"event": "APPROVE"
}Events: APPROVE, REQUEST_CHANGES, COMMENT
Search
Search Repositories
GET /github/search/repositories?q={query}&per_page=30Example queries:
tetris+language:python- Repositories with "tetris" in Pythonreact+stars:>10000- Repositories with "react" and 10k+ stars
Search Issues
GET /github/search/issues?q={query}&per_page=30Example queries:
bug+is:open+is:issue- Open issues containing "bug"author:username+is:pr- Pull requests by author
Search Code
GET /github/search/code?q={query}&per_page=30Example queries:
addClass+repo:facebook/react- Search for "addClass" in a specific repofunction+extension:js- JavaScript functions
Note: Code search may timeout on broad queries.

}Pagination
GitHub uses page-based and link-based pagination:
GET /github/repos/{owner}/{repo}/issues?per_page=30&page=2Response headers include pagination links:
Link: <url>; rel="next", <url>; rel="last"
Common pagination parameters:
per_page: Results per page (max 100, default 30)page: Page number (default 1)
Some endpoints use cursor-based pagination with since parameter (e.g., listing users).

issues = response.json()Notes
- Repository names are case-insensitive but the API preserves case
- Issue numbers and PR numbers share the same sequence per repository
- Content must be Base64 encoded when creating/updating files
- Rate limits: 5000 requests/hour for authenticated users, 30 searches/minute
- Search queries may timeout on very broad patterns

Error Handling
| Status | Meaning |
|---|---|
| 400 | Missing GitHub connection |
| 401 | Invalid or missing Maton API key |
| 403 | Forbidden - insufficient permissions or scope |
| 404 | Resource not found |
| 408 | Request timeout (common for complex searches) |
| 422 | Validation failed |
| 429 | Rate limited |
| 4xx/5xx | Passthrough error from GitHub API |
